Questões de Concurso Comentadas por alunos sobre teste de software em engenharia de software

Foram encontradas 1.109 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q1086712 Engenharia de Software
Teste é um conjunto de atividades que podem ser planejadas com antecedência e executadas sistematicamente. Deverá ser definido, para o processo de software, um conjunto de etapas nas quais podem-se empregar técnicas específicas de projeto de caso de teste e métodos de teste. O processo de software pode ser visto como a espiral ilustrada na figura a seguir. Inicialmente, a engenharia de sistemas define o papel do software e passa à análise dos requisitos de software, na qual são estabelecidos o domínio da informação, função, comportamento, desempenho, restrições e critérios de validação para o software. Deslocando-se para o interior da espiral, chega-se ao projeto e, finalmente, à codificação.
Imagem associada para resolução da questão PRESSMAN, R. S. Engenharia de software: uma abordagem profissional. São Paulo: McGraw-Hill, 2011 (adaptado).
Uma estratégia para teste de software também pode ser vista no conceito da espiral, como na figura, correlacionando o modelo de teste adotado à fase na qual o software se encontra. A alternativa que corresponde corretamente às respectivas fases de teste numeradas na figura como 1, 2, 3 e 4 é:
Alternativas
Q1086353 Engenharia de Software
Qual alternativa define corretamente o conceito de Test-Driven Development?
Alternativas
Q1085001 Engenharia de Software
Dentre as proposições abaixo, assinale a alternativa correta.
Alternativas
Q1084999 Engenharia de Software
A respeito de princípios básicos para elaboração de testes de software, assinale a alternativa correta.
Alternativas
Q1084998 Engenharia de Software
Conforme a descrição do planejamento de testes e inspeções no PMBOK, analise as proposições abaixo.
1) O gerente do projeto e a equipe do projeto determinam como testar ou inspecionar o produto, a entrega ou o serviço, para satisfazer as necessidades e expectativas das partes interessadas. 2) O planejamento de testes e inspeções é usado para determinar e identificar uma abordagem para garantir que recursos suficientes estejam disponíveis para a conclusão bem-sucedida do projeto. 3) Os testes e inspeções variam conforme o setor e podem incluir, por exemplo, testes alfa e beta em projetos de software. 4) O gerente do projeto determina no planejamento de testes quais as funcionalidades que serão priorizadas com verificação estática ou dinâmica de código.
Estão corretas, apenas:
Alternativas
Respostas
376: D
377: B
378: E
379: D
380: B